A quick question. My son is weaning off Lamotrigine or lamictal. He was on it for 3 weeks and had an extreme hypomanic reaction, when he went up to 50 mg, so the Doctors are weaning him off of it over 2 weeks. He went down from 50 mg to 25 mg and has been there for one week. Here comes the question..my regular doctor and pharmacist told me for the second week (which he starts tomorrow) to taper him down to 12.5 mg for the last week as this would be easier on his system. But the neurologist (who I don't really like much) said to leave him on 25 mg for the 2 week wean and then take him off. Any answers? I just want what is best for my 13 year old. Thanks. The website for the medicine says discontinue over at least a two week period of 50% a week. But I am assuming this information is for someone who has been on it for a while.
 
Personally I've always thought that the best way to wean off of an anti-epileptic drug is the slowest.

Anything too fast can trigger more seizures.
 
I was on Lamictal for 16 days and had an allergic reaction to it. I couldnt wean off of it due to how severe my allergic reaction was, so I just had to stop it. That was 3 days ago. Ive had no problems since "knock on wood".

Ive heard its best to wean off any anti- seizure drug as slow as possible, if you dont have any reason to come off of it quickly at the time.
 
I agree with Eric -- slower, at smaller increments can't hurt. He might be okay going from 25mg to zero, but it won't hurt to go from 25mg to 12.5mg to zero, and might help.
